Marcus Shapiro is joined by Dave Fatula, White Mountains hiking expert and founder of Guineafowl Adventure Company.  Dave successfully makes a strong pitch for why hiking in the White Mountains (in New Hampshire) is one of the most fun, beautiful, and rugged destinations in the Lower 48. Your challenge is to listen and then ask yourself how long you can resist before having to experience hikes in the Whites for yourself.  He calls the White Mountains, Boston’s Backyard.  Marcus and Dave talk fitness, trails you should hike, spectacular views above the treeline and much more… Below is a sampling of discussion topics:

- Why is it important to feel, see, challenge, and immerse yourself in nature and what’s unique about the ruggedness of the White Mountains?

- Make your pitch to the Northeasterner to hike in the White Mountains.

- Make your pitch to the hikers out West who will belittle the 4000-footers vs 14,000-foot peaks.

- Talk about the challenging trails that sometimes go straight up and down without switchbacks and why that is. 

- Hiking in the White Mountains vs Adirondacks vs Mahoosucs.

- Discuss the overwhelming number of stunning views above the tree line in the unique alpine tundra.

- Talk about the iconic Mount Washington hike and important safety measures you should take.

- Discuss peak bagging the 48 peaks within New Hampshire and one in Maine, over 4,000 feet, known as the four-thousand footers.

Let’s discuss the technical nature of the White Mountain National Forest and how a proper fitness level makes hiking much more fun, rewarding, and safe.

- Favorite musical band for Musical Trekking.

- Discuss some beginner, intermediate, and challenging hikes in the White Mountains.

- Discuss that the White Mountain National Forest is home to some of the most formidable terrain on the entire Appalachian Trail.

- What is the most common positive thing people say about the entire experience when hiking with the Guineafowl Adventure Company for the first time?
